How Our Residential Water Removal Process Works

At the heart of our Residential Water Removal service is a meticulous process designed to extract water, dry out your property, and prevent secondary damage. Our team follows a strict protocol to ensure every step is executed correctly. We’ll never sacrifice quality for speed. Our crew will:

Assessment and Containment

We start by assessing the extent of the damage and identifying the source of the water. Our team will contain the affected area to prevent further water from spreading, using plastic sheets and sandbags to keep the area dry.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and creating a safe working environment. Our team will also take moisture readings to find out the best course of action.

Water Extraction

Once the area is contained, our team will begin extracting the water using powerful pumps and vacuums. We’ll remove any standing water, including up to 2 inches of water, to prevent further damage. Our team will also remove any damaged materials, such as drywall and carpeting, to prevent mold growth and bacterial contamination. This step is critical in preventing further damage and ensuring a thorough dry-out.

Structural Drying

After the initial water extraction, our team will begin the structural drying process. We’ll use specialized equipment to dry out the affected area, including dehumidifiers and air movers. Our team will also monitor moisture levels to ensure the area is properly dried. This step can take anywhere from 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.

Sanitizing and Cleaning

Once the area is dry, our team will sanitize and clean the affected area to prevent mold growth and bacterial contamination. We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ning solutions and equipment to ensure a thorough and safe cleaning process.

Final Inspection and Restoration

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ure the area is completely dry and free from any hidden moisture. We’ll also identify any necessary repairs or replacements, including drywall, flooring, and other materials.

Warning Signs You Need Residential Water Removal

Ignoring the warning signs of water damage can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Our team has seen it all, and we’re here to help you identify the signs that need immediate attention. Here are some common warning sign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old and mildew. These microorganisms thrive in damp environments and can cause serious health issues. Our team will investigate the source of the odor and provide a solution to remove it.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can signal that water has seeped into the subfloor. Our team will assess the damage and provide a plan to restore your floors to their original condition.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can show water damage behind the surface. Our team will investigate the cause and provide a solution to prevent further damage.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Water stains can signal that water has leaked through the roof or walls. Our team will assess the damage and provide a plan to repair or replace the affected area.

Damp or Musty Smells in the Attic or Basement

Unpleasant odors in the attic or basement can show water damage. Our team will investigate the source and provide a solution to remove it.

Visible Water Leaks or Drips

Visible water leaks or drips can show a serious issue that needs immediate attention. Our team will assess the damage and provide a plan to repair or replace the affected area.

Residential Water Removal Cost in Robertsdale, AL

The cost of Residential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Robertsdale, AL. Our team will provide a free estimate after assessing the damage. Here are some estimated costs for different aspects of the service: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ions.
Water Extraction $1,000 – $5,000 Amount of water, type of equipment needed, and labor costs.
Structural Drying $1,500 – $6,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or costs.
Sanitizing and Cleaning $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ning solution needed, and labor costs.
Final Inspection and Restoration $1,000 – $4,000 Size of affected area, type of repairs needed, and labor costs.
